What is a poultry farm?

A Poultry Farm job involves raising and caring for chickens, turkeys, or other birds for meat, eggs, or breeding. Responsibilities may include feeding, cleaning, monitoring bird health, collecting eggs, and maintaining farm equipment. Workers may also assist with vaccinations and ensuring proper living conditions for the birds. The job can be physically demanding and requires attention to detail. It plays a crucial role in food production and the agricultural industry.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of someone working on a poultry farm?

On a poultry farm, your daily responsibilities may include feeding and watering the birds, monitoring their health, cleaning and maintaining coops or barns, and operating specialized equipment. You might also be involved in collecting eggs, keeping records of production, and administering vaccinations or medications as needed. The role often requires close attention to animal welfare and adherence to biosecurity standards to prevent disease. Teamwork is important, as you may coordinate with supervisors, veterinarians, or other staff to manage schedules and respond to any issues that arise. This hands-on work is crucial to maintaining healthy flocks and ensuring the smooth running of the farm.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the poultry farm position, and why are they important?

To thrive on a poultry farm, you need practical knowledge of animal husbandry, poultry health management, and farm operations, often supported by experience or training in agricultural science. Familiarity with automated feeding systems, climate control equipment, and biosecurity protocols is highly valued, and certain roles may require certification in food safety or animal welfare. Attention to detail, strong problem-solving abilities, and teamwork are essential soft skills for maintaining flock health and efficiency. These skills and qualities ensure safe, productive farm operations and compliance with industry regulations.
